KPV Peptide Overview
KPV is a naturally occurring tripeptide (lysine-proline-valine) corresponding to the C-terminal fragment of alpha-melanocyte-stimulating hormone (α-MSH). It is studied in research primarily for its anti-inflammatory signaling.
Anti-Inflammatory Signaling
KPV is studied for its ability to enter cells and down-regulate pro-inflammatory pathways, including NF-κB signaling and the production of inflammatory cytokines, in research models.
Gut Inflammation Research
A prominent area of KPV research is the intestinal tract, where it is investigated in models of colitis and mucosal inflammation for its effects on epithelial cells and immune signaling.
Skin and Tissue Research
KPV’s anti-inflammatory activity is also studied in dermal and wound-related research models, where inflammation influences tissue outcomes.
Specifications
- CAS Number: 67727-97-3
- Molecular Formula: C16H30N4O3
- Sequence: Lys-Pro-Val (L-Lysyl-L-Prolyl-L-Valine)
- Molar Mass: 326.44 g/mol
- Class: Anti-inflammatory tripeptide (α-MSH C-terminal fragment)
